Solution

The correct option is B Both Assertion and Reason are correct but Reason is not the correct explanation for Assertion
If the polar of a point A pases through B and the polar of B passes through A , then points A and B are called conjugate points
If the pole of one line lies on other and the pole of other line lies on first one then these lines are called conjugate lines
Both the above statements are correct but the reason is not correct explanation of the assertion
